summaryrefslogtreecommitdiff
path: root/Makefile
diff options
context:
space:
mode:
authorMartin Schirrmacher <vdr.skinflatplus@schirrmacher.eu>2014-12-02 19:51:22 +0100
committerMartin Schirrmacher <vdr.skinflatplus@schirrmacher.eu>2014-12-02 19:51:22 +0100
commitd3b96ad7049e9ab23111d78cf21b87c302ba908a (patch)
tree9d3aa20635dc2fca88ca12b13a7cf1919fb64910 /Makefile
parent78947f958107a42df423c73da9c9807fb229ad9a (diff)
downloadskin-flatplus-d3b96ad7049e9ab23111d78cf21b87c302ba908a.tar.gz
skin-flatplus-d3b96ad7049e9ab23111d78cf21b87c302ba908a.tar.bz2
update Makefile
Diffstat (limited to 'Makefile')
-rw-r--r--Makefile11
1 files changed, 6 insertions, 5 deletions
diff --git a/Makefile b/Makefile
index 10f4d6d5..168e4dbe 100644
--- a/Makefile
+++ b/Makefile
@@ -23,7 +23,7 @@ PLUGIN = skinflatplus
# vdrlogo_xubuntu
# vdrlogo_xubuntu2
# vdrlogo_yavdr
-VDRLOGO = vdrlogo_default
+SKINFLATPLUS_VDRLOGO = vdrlogo_default
#DEFINES += -DDEBUGIMAGELOADTIME
#DEFINES += -DDEBUGEPGTIME
@@ -42,6 +42,7 @@ PLGCFG = $(call PKGCFG,plgcfg)
VDRCONFDIR = $(call PKGCFG,configdir)
PLGRESDIR = $(call PKGCFG,resdir)/plugins/$(PLUGIN)
TMPDIR ?= /tmp
+SKINFLATPLUS_WIDGETDIR ?= $(LIBDIR)/$(PLUGIN)/widgets
### The compiler options:
export CFLAGS = $(call PKGCFG,cflags)
@@ -67,8 +68,8 @@ SOFILE = libvdr-$(PLUGIN).so
INCLUDES += $(shell pkg-config --cflags Magick++ freetype2 fontconfig)
-DEFINES += -DPLUGIN_NAME_I18N='"$(PLUGIN)"' -DVDRLOGO=\"$(VDRLOGO)\"
-DEFINES += -DWIDGETFOLDER='"$(LIBDIR)/$(PLUGIN)/widgets"'
+DEFINES += -DPLUGIN_NAME_I18N='"$(PLUGIN)"' -DVDRLOGO=\"$(SKINFLATPLUS_VDRLOGO)\"
+DEFINES += -DWIDGETFOLDER='"$(SKINFLATPLUS_WIDGETDIR)"'
LIBS += $(shell pkg-config --libs Magick++)
@@ -146,8 +147,8 @@ install-configs:
cp configs/* $(DESTDIR)$(VDRCONFDIR)/plugins/$(PLUGIN)/configs
install-widgets:
- mkdir -p $(DESTDIR)$(LIBDIR)/$(PLUGIN)/widgets
- cp -r widgets/* $(DESTDIR)$(LIBDIR)/$(PLUGIN)/widgets
+ mkdir -p $(DESTDIR)$(SKINFLATPLUS_WIDGETDIR)
+ cp -r widgets/* $(DESTDIR)$(SKINFLATPLUS_WIDGETDIR)
install: install-lib install-i18n install-themes install-icons install-decors install-configs install-widgets